(1)(1)(a) Except as provided in Subsections (1)(c), (d), and (e), the division upon registering a vehicle shall issue to the owner:
(1)(a)(i) one license plate for a motorcycle, trailer, or semitrailer;
(1)(a)(ii) one registration decal for a park model recreational vehicle, in lieu of a license plate, which shall be attached in plain sight to the rear of the park model recreational vehicle;
(1)(a)(iii) one registration decal for a camper, in lieu of a license plate, which shall be attached in plain sight to the rear of the camper; and
(1)(a)(iv) one license plate for every other vehicle.
